It was a great night at the Roxy in Hollywood when band Shirock decided to lend a helping hand to the needy.
On March 2, the up and coming band from Nashville hosted “Everything Burns in Hollywood,” a charity event, that The Breeze was invited to, that is designed to aid the homeless in Los Angeles and raise awareness for those who suffer on Skid Row.
The event, named after Shirock’s debut album “Everything Burns,” was a Hollywood send off for the band.
However, instead of charging for tickets, attendees were asked to donate clothing or cash to charity Midnight Mission. In exchange, guests were treated to a fashion show, and two live bands. Shirock played first, followed by Los Angeles band The Daylights.
Special guests of the event included host Michael Welch (Twilight), Joanna Sims (Days of Our Lives) and troop of models.
